To manage and play a collection of 217 games, it's essential to understand the technology behind the files. , which stands for Wii Backup File System , is a proprietary file system created specifically for the Nintendo Wii by homebrew coders kwiirk and Waninkoko. 217 Wii games. -wbfs format-
